              @chrishamm - got all the files [ 9 of them i reckon ] onto USB stick. got it sorted on how to MOUNT the USB to /mnt/usb/Duet3SBC/

              executed sudo dpkg -i *.deb from that folder ...

              Things seem to be going well packages unpacked - files overwiriting and it advises 2 boards out of date:

              Duet 3 Mini 5+ [ 3.4.0 beta3 ]
              Duet 3 Expansion Tool1LC [ 3.3 ] ... a brand new 1.2v board

              Would you like to update them all [ Y/N ]
              Y
              .. Updating firmware on Board 121....

              seems to be taking a good bit ... like to the point Im worried its stuck ... after getting this far LOL

                If it's taking more than a couple minutes it's probably finished and hasn't moved on. A power cycle would likely indicate that the firmware has been updated successfully. Take comfort that it's not possible to brick a board with a firmware update.
